Séminaire LGF – Victor Gonzalez-Castro – 27 novembre 2025

Titre
Inspection des surfaces et porosité des matériaux métalliques avec vision artificielle et apprentissage automatique
Résumé
In this talk, I will present two recent works carried out at the University of León on applying computer vision and machine learning to surface inspection in metal additive manufacturing. The first one focuses on non-contact estimation of arithmetical mean roughness (Ra) in stainless-steel parts. We developed an image-based methodology that combines classical texture descriptors (Haralick, LBP and Dense SIFT) with regression models to predict surface roughness from simple photographs.
The second work addresses defect detection in aluminium alloy castings produced using 3D-printed molds via binder jetting. We introduce the Porosity Detection Corpus, a dataset of metallographic images annotated with shrinkage and gas pores, and evaluate a YOLO-based object detection system to automatically locate and classify these defects.
